Rlys to have 100% bio-toilets by 2019

Last Updated 20 July 2018, 13:01 IST

The Railways will have 100 % bio-toilets by next year that will make tracks safe and eliminate defecation on the rail lines, Railway Minister Piyush Goyal informed the Rajya Sabha on Friday.

So far around 60% of the railway coaches have been fitted with bio-toilets. The work on the remaining coaches is going on expeditiously and it will be completed by 2019, the minister said.

Goyal said this will completely eliminate defecation on the tracks, which is not only unhygienic but affects rail safety because the uric acid damages tracks, causing accidents.

He said work was on the retro-fit additional vacuum-assisted flushing units in these toilets have been developed with help of the DRDO under the 'Make In India' drive instead of importing them.
